Definition of bluewing -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
1.
insectRare blue-winged insect, especially a butterflyRare
- A bluewing fluttered by, catching the sunlight on its iridescent wings.
2.
birdRare duck with blue wing patchesRare
- The bluewing flew gracefully over the lake.
3.
botanyRare plant with vibrant blue flowersRare
- The garden was full of blooming bluewings.
